Natural Characteristics (Not Considered Defects):

  1. Slight differences in shape, size, and color

  2. Flowing or pooled glaze marks

  3. Small bubbles formed during kiln firing

  4. Non-uniform color due to kiln position and temperature

  5. Iron spots caused by natural minerals in the clay

Care Instructions:

  • Do not soak; wash promptly and dry thoroughly

  • Use soft sponges for cleaning

  • Avoid storing food for extended periods to prevent staining

  • Metallic utensils may scratch matte surfaces

  • Matte finishes may develop marks from oil or dairy products

  • Not safe for direct flame or oven use unless otherwise specified
